  • WHAT HAPPENED?

    Atalanta legend Josip Ilicic has opined on Kylian Mbappe's current form at Real Madrid amid this week's Champions League clash between the two and has claimed that it is impossible for him to match the legacy of a great like Cristiano Ronaldo, who is Madrid's all-time top scorer. The Slovenia icon also dived into the reasons that have led to Mbappe going through a remarkably torrid time.

    THE BIGGER PICTURE

    It is no secret that Mbappe grew up idolising Ronaldo and followed his exploits at Real Madrid, where he would go on to create history both collectively and individually. In fact, Mbappe even recreated the famous "Uno, dos, tres, Hala Madrid!" part from Ronaldo's record-breaking presentation in 2009 during his own presentation last summer.

    However, it hasn't been smooth sailing for the French forward thus far. Mbappe got on the scoresheet in Madrid's recent 3-0 win over Girona, bringing his tally to 11 goals from 21 games this season. But numbers aside, the No. 9 has looked out of touch and out of confidence at times.

  • WHAT JOSIP ILICIC SAID

    Speaking to AS, Ilicic said: "I think there is a fundamental error. In Mbappe's role, there's already a player at Madrid who almost won the Ballon d'Or. And they had to adapt Mbappe as a center forward. I don't see him doing well there. You can tell he's always looking to open up where Vini is. And honestly I expected that. He is suffering a lot as a striker, he has less space and little support to free himself. Then add enormous pressure and expectations to this. People expected to see him do what Cristiano did and that is impossible. Messi and he were from another planet. In France, moreover, he felt more defended. In Madrid the expectations are something else. If you don't score goals, you're deemed worthless."

    WHAT NEXT FOR KYLIAN MBAPPE?

    Mbappe's interview with Canal+ was released on Sunday, in which the France international touched upon the problems which he has had to deal with since arriving in the Spanish capital, including his omission from the French national team.

    His goal against Girona was a typical Mbappe finish, but apart from that, he looked more confident and sharp in the second half, occupying more central positions and making some nice off-ball runs. Both the fans and his teammates will be hoping that Mbappe uses the Girona display as a springboard to unleash his best version for the remainder of the season.
